1. Plan Your Layout
Before you start filling your large living room, it’s essential to plan your layout. This involves deciding on the furniture arrangement that will work best for your space. Consider the following tips:
– Use a focal point: Choose a piece of furniture or decor that will serve as the centerpiece of your room, such as a fireplace, television, or a large piece of artwork.
– Define seating areas: Group furniture together to create cozy seating areas that encourage conversation and relaxation.
– Leave room for movement: Ensure there is enough space for people to move around comfortably without tripping over furniture or feeling cramped.
2. Choose the Right Furniture
Selecting the right furniture is crucial for filling a large living room effectively. Here are some tips to help you make the best choices:
– Scale: Opt for larger furniture pieces that complement the room’s size without overwhelming it.
– Multi-functional furniture: Incorporate pieces that serve multiple purposes, such as a coffee table with storage or a sofa with a pull-out bed.
– Comfort: Prioritize comfort when choosing furniture, as you want your living room to be a welcoming space for relaxation and entertainment.
3. Add Decor and Accessories
Decor and accessories can make a significant impact on the ambiance of your large living room. Here are some ideas:
– Layer lighting: Use a combination of ambient, task, and accent lighting to create a warm and inviting atmosphere.
– Artwork and mirrors: Display artwork and mirrors to add visual interest and balance the room’s proportions.
– Textiles: Incorporate throw pillows, blankets, and area rugs to add texture and color to the space.
4. Use Rugs and Textiles to Define Spaces
Rugs and textiles can be a great way to define different areas within your large living room. Here’s how to use them effectively:
– Area rugs: Place area rugs in front of seating areas to create cozy, defined spaces.
– Throw blankets: Drape throw blankets over furniture to add warmth and texture.
– Curtains: Use curtains to define the boundaries of a particular area, such as a reading nook or a home office.
5. Incorporate Natural Elements
Bringing in natural elements can help make your large living room feel more grounded and inviting. Consider the following ideas:
– Plants: Add plants to your living room to bring in fresh air and create a serene atmosphere.
– Natural light: Utilize natural light by keeping windows unobstructed and considering the placement of mirrors to reflect light.
– Natural materials: Incorporate natural materials such as wood, stone, or bamboo in your decor to add warmth and texture.
